The Post was getting ready for its semiannual Poppy Drive which enables its members to be at the markets in the valley passing out poppies to raise money for our disabled and homeless veterans. Memorial Day, the holiday which remembers our servicemen who gave their lives for our country is taken seriously and members got out there to spread the word and poppies.
